Market Position
2LIVEPROPERTIES LTD operates within the niche of letting and managing own or leased real estate, classified under SIC code 68209. As a micro-entity established in 2020, it occupies a small-scale position in the UK property management sector. The company has maintained a stable asset base with fixed assets valued at approximately £58.7k, indicating ownership or control of property assets, but it operates with minimal human resources (no employees reported) and limited equity (£2.96k shareholders’ funds as of 2024).Strategic Assets

The company faces liquidity challenges as evidenced by persistent net current liabilities (~£10.8k in 2024), which could constrain operational agility. The absence of employees may limit capacity to manage growth or complex property portfolios. Being a micro-entity with minimal equity buffer exposes it to risks from market fluctuations in real estate values or rental demand downturns. Dependence on a single director and a major shareholder (25-50% ownership) introduces governance concentration risk. Furthermore, as a private limited company in a competitive sector, lack of scale and brand recognition may impede market penetration.
